
Team profile
Arema FC
Born from the fiery spirit of East Java, Arema Football Club emerged in 1987 in the city of Malang. The club's name is a tribute to a legendary warrior from Javanese folklore, symbolizing courage and tenacity. This ethos is encapsulated in their famous nickname, "Singo Edan" (The Crazy Lions), and their iconic blue and red colors. Their home, the Kanjuruhan Stadium in Kepanjen, Malang, has been a fortress for the club and its famously passionate supporters. Arema's history is marked by significant achievements, including winning the Indonesian Premier League title in 2009 and the Indonesian League Cup in 2005 and 2006. While they have not competed in major continental competitions, they are a consistent force in Indonesian football. The club's identity is built on a never-say-die attitude, often playing an aggressive, attacking style of football that mirrors the fervor of their fans. The club has been graced by legendary players such as Indonesian internationals Noh Alam Shah and Cristian Gonzales, as well as foreign stars who became icons. The fan culture is among the most vibrant in Southeast Asia; the "Aremania" are a massive, loyal, and creative supporter group known for their spectacular choreography and deafening noise, creating an intimidating atmosphere for any visiting team. Their most intense rivalry is the "Derbi Jawa Timur" against Persebaya Surabaya, one of the most heated and historic derbies in Indonesian football. Matches against Persija Jakarta also carry significant weight. Currently competing in Indonesia's top-flight Liga 1, Arema FC continues to be a major force, though the club and its community were profoundly affected by the tragic stadium disaster in 2022, an event that has deeply impacted its journey. Despite challenges, the spirit of the "Crazy Lions" endures, fueled by a legacy of passion and resilience.
